Abstract

In this PhD project, I propose a critical analysis of the Brazilian artistic production in the passage of the 60 to 70-twentieth century, within the assumptions of feminist theories of cultural criticism, with emphasis on the possibilities for female subjectivity through artistic practice. To be more specific, I am concerned here with certain works done by Sonia Andrade, Iole de Freitas, Gretta Sarfatty and Letícia Parente - Brazilian artists contemporary from each other and from the advent of second wave feminism in the country - which involving the visual and aesthetic concerns of time, linked to conceptual and experimental issues, and allow an approach to feminist criticism precisely because they work with body and identity issues, and enabling mainly encompass the limitations and/or possibilities of aesthetic education by clashes/subversions of gender.
